    Luke Pearson est un artiste de bande dessinée et illustrateur acclamé, réputé pour sa narration visuelle captivante. Ses œuvres, souvent comparées à un mélange de récits d'aventure classiques et au style imaginatif du Studio Ghibli, transportent les lecteurs dans des mondes magiques habités par des créatures cachées. L'approche artistique distinctive et les techniques narratives imaginatives de Pearson en ont fait une voix de premier plan dans la bande dessinée britannique contemporaine. Ses créations sont célébrées pour leur sophistication visuelle et leur capacité à évoquer un sentiment d'émerveillement et d'aventure.

      The newest book in the beloved Hilda series continues the action-packed adventures with our beloved Hilda stuck in the body of a troll trying to save all of human and troll-kind! Hilda and the Mountain King takes off from the cliff hanger in Hilda and the Stone Forest that left you waiting breathlessly! We rejoin our heroine for her latest adventure just as she awakes to find herself in the body of a troll! Her mother is worried sick, and is perplexed by the strange creature that seems to have taken Hilda's place. Now, both of them are in a race to be reunited before Ahlberg and his safety patrol get the chance to use their new secret weapon to lay waste to the trolls, and Hilda along with them!

      Hilda's visit to her Great Aunt Astrid in Tofoten reveals a hidden fairy village, sparking her curiosity and unease. As she navigates the enchanting yet perilous world filled with fantastic creatures, she is haunted by a mysterious radio presenter and unsettling dreams. This adventure challenges her understanding of reality and family secrets, leaving her to confront dangers while seeking answers to her pressing questions.

      Hilda embarks on a thrilling adventure as she encounters a familiar figure at Trolberg harbour, prompting her to confront her past. A visit to castle ruins leads her to the faratok tree and the Time of Giants, where she uncovers the story of the Giant Slayer. Driven by a desire to aid the Giants and foster peace, Hilda faces the challenge of altering history while grappling with her own struggles.
